The Weekly Rhythm of Gut Function

Digestion is not static. It responds to circadian rhythms, hormonal cycles, stress, diet variations, and even the lunar cycle in subtle ways. Studies on gut motility reveal that gastric emptying can slow during high-stress weeks or shift dramatically when carbohydrate intake fluctuates. This explains why the same meal that digests smoothly on Monday might cause discomfort by Thursday.

Key players include GLP-1 and GIP, incretin hormones released by intestinal L-cells and K-cells after meals. GLP-1 slows gastric emptying to promote satiety and stable blood sugar, while GIP influences both insulin and lipid metabolism. Their secretion varies with meal composition and timing, creating noticeable weekly changes in appetite, energy, and bowel habits.

Leptin sensitivity also plays a role. When systemic inflammation rises—marked by elevated C-Reactive Protein (CRP)—the brain becomes less responsive to leptin’s “I am full” signal. High-sugar or high-lectin meals can trigger this within days, leading to increased hunger and altered motility. An anti-inflammatory protocol emphasizing nutrient-dense, low-lectin foods like bok choy helps restore balance quickly.

Inflammation, Mitochondria, and Metabolic Flexibility

Chronic low-grade inflammation is a hidden driver of erratic digestion. Elevated CRP correlates strongly with insulin resistance (measured by HOMA-IR) and disrupted gut barrier function. When mitochondria become less efficient due to oxidative stress or toxin burden, cellular energy production drops. This mitochondrial inefficiency reduces fat oxidation, promotes fat storage, and indirectly slows gut motility.

Improving mitochondrial efficiency through targeted nutrition, strategic fasting windows, and therapies like red light can stabilize digestion within weeks. The body begins producing ketones more readily, providing steady energy to intestinal cells and reducing inflammatory signaling. This metabolic shift explains why many experience smoother digestion once they move beyond the outdated CICO model and focus on food quality and hormonal timing.

Body composition further influences outcomes. Higher lean muscle mass supports a healthier Basal Metabolic Rate (BMR), which in turn supports consistent energy for digestive processes. Losing fat while preserving muscle—tracked via precise body composition analysis—creates a virtuous cycle of improved gut function and metabolic health.

What the Research Says: An FAQ

Q: Why does my digestion feel different every week?
A: Weekly changes reflect shifts in incretin hormones (GLP-1, GIP), inflammation markers like CRP, mitochondrial efficiency, and even circadian alignment. Research in metabolic physiology consistently links these variables to gut motility and microbial composition.

Q: Can tirzepatide help stabilize digestion long-term?
A: When used strategically in a reset protocol, tirzepatide’s dual agonism improves glycemic control, reduces inflammation, and supports fat loss while allowing patients to learn sustainable habits. The goal is metabolic independence, not perpetual use.

Q: Is the lectin-free approach necessary?
A: For individuals with elevated CRP or suspected sensitivities, reducing lectin load can lower intestinal permeability and systemic inflammation within weeks, according to clinical observations in functional metabolic medicine.

Q: How do I maintain results after aggressive loss phases?
A: The maintenance phase is critical. Focus on nutrient-dense foods, resistance training to protect BMR and muscle mass, ongoing stress management, and periodic biomarker testing. This prevents rebound inflammation and weight regain.

Q: What role do ketones play in gut health?
A: Ketones serve as efficient fuel for colonocytes, reduce oxidative stress, and exert anti-inflammatory effects. Achieving mild nutritional ketosis through dietary structure often correlates with more stable digestion and better energy.
